Don’t miss the upcoming Summer Boys Basketball Camps at Skyline!
May 26, 2009Grades 10-12
May 26th – 28th, from 5 p.m. – 7:30 p.m.
This camp is an important learning opportunity that should not be missed by any current or prospective Skyline basketball player. The entire Skyline coaching staff will be teaching fundamentals, offenses, defensive principles, and much more. If you haven’t already, please email Coach Shippen to let him know that you plan to attend. This camp is free for those attending tournaments or helping with younger kids camps. Otherwise it’s $40.
Grades 1-6
June 2nd-3rd (5:00pm-7:30pm) and June 4th (9:00am-11:30am) Cost: $40
Fundamentals, games, competitions, fun!
All players will receive a nice reversible Grizz jersey.
Grades 7-9
June 8-10th from 5:00 to 7:30 p.m. Cost: $40
Fundamentals, competitions, offenses and defenses, and more.
All players will receive a nice reversible Grizz jersey.
Email Coach Ty Shippen with player’s name, grade, and phone number to pre-register. Payment and a signed waiver should be completed at the door. Proceeds from the camps go to the Skyline Boys Basketball Program.
